Назад | Перейти на главную страницу

Apache2 динамическое настраиваемое имя файла для файлов журнала

Я хотел бы применить настраиваемое имя файла на основе даты для файлов журнала apache2, которое я хочу использовать для Clickheat. в пример он пишет:

CustomLog "clickheat.%Y-%m-%d-%H" "%r" env=clickheat

Но для меня он создает файл с именем clickheat.%Y-%m-%d-%H переменные не подставляются.

Я не нашел в документации apache2, какой параметр следует включить или установить.

Вы должны отправить журналы команде ("| / usr / bin / rotatelogs <path_with_format> <time | size>"). Как этот:

# Check path to rotatelogs and log file directory
CustomLog "|/usr/bin/rotatelogs /var/log/apache/clickheat.%Y-%m-%d-%H 3600" "%r" env=clickheat